Ghadhi bin Fahd al-Zabiyani, an official with the organizing committee, said those taking the course were given lessons on proper pronunciation of the letters and words, Gulf365 website reported.
He added that they also learned more about Uthmani script and its features.
According to the official 50 expatriates from 13 countries took the online course.
He said it was aimed at enhancing the Quranic skills of memorizers and Quran teachers.
Since the outbreak of the coronavirus pandemic and restrictions imposed to prevent the spread of the disease, many Quranic programs in different countries have gone online.
